description
From December 2026, our current CMS will no longer receive official support, bug fixes, or security patches from Kentico, necessitating a need to rebuild and upgrade, or rebuild and move to a new CMS.
We need to build a simplified website where external audiences connect with the information and opportunities they seek through clear, intuitive and inspiring content. The current highly bespoke website cannot be transferred’ to a new CMS in its current state.
The website contains a mix of prospect and applicant, existing student, staff, community and research-focused information, sitting within a complex and highly bespoke code-structure that is difficult to maintain, and with no in-house developers to do so.
To better support our workforce, all staff-facing content will be relocated from the external website to a dedicated Intranet-style solution. This transition ensures that by 2027, staff will have a single, authoritative point of entry for the information and tools they need to perform their roles effectively.
The University is also looking at introducing a student facing app along a similar timeframe as the new CMS. Unlike some other university apps that primarily serve as access points to other systems, this app would be purposefully integrated into the learning experience. Its use would be connected to assessment, reflection, and skills development, positioning the University as a sector leader in how digital tools are embedded in education to support student success.
We’re also keen to be challenged - we’re looking internally at what we need, but are hoping to be introduced to what else might be possible.
